Avatar billede rafix Nybegynder
17. november 2005 - 13:24 Der er 5 kommentarer

Problemer med dynamisk tekstfelt - aøå

Jeg har problemer med et dynamisk tekst felt som ikke vil vise æ ø og å?
Jeg har prøvet at ligge - system.useCodePage = true; - ind i første frame af min timeline men uden held.

Teksten bliver hentet ind via en asp fil med koden - Response.write "Tekst=" & Server.URLEncode(rsNyheder("Tekst"))

Nogen som har erfaringer med dette problem?
Tak..
Avatar billede alexander_j Nybegynder
17. november 2005 - 13:56 #1
Kan forestille mig at det er URLEncode der er problemet!

når du modtager din tekst i flashen bliver du nød til at URLEncode den tilbage igen.

i flash hedder kommandoerne escape og unescape - et eksempel kunne være:
trace( escape("hej mor æ ø å") );
trace( unescape("hej%20mor%20%C3%A6%20%C3%B8%20%C3%A5") );

escape laver teksten "hej mor æ ø å" og til "hej%20mor%20%C3%A6%20%C3%B8%20%C3%A5" og unescape ændre det tilbage igen.

En anden ting som du naturligvis også skal tjekke er om den font du har brugt i dit tekstfelt har æøå og sidst men ikke mindst skal du også tjekke om du har embed fonten, og i så fald skal du huske også at vælge 'æøåÆØÅ'

Vh/Alexander
Avatar billede rafix Nybegynder
17. november 2005 - 14:33 #2
Virker stadig ikke - men jeg er ikke sikker på at jeg indsætter koden rigtigt??
Jeg prøvede at sætte "unescape" ind i koden så den ser ud som flg:

stop();
var aspVars = new LoadVars();
aspVars.load("nyheder.asp");
aspVars.onLoad = function(ok){
  if(ok){
    strTextarea.html = true;
    strTextarea.htmlText = unescape (this.Tekst);
  }else{
    trace("Failed to load ASP");
  }
}
Avatar billede alexander_j Nybegynder
20. november 2005 - 09:11 #3
og du er sikker på at fonten har æ.ø og å -
og du er sikker på at du har lavet feltet som et dynamisk textfield -
og du er sikker på at du ikke har embed fonten i feltet, og hvis du har, så har du husket at tilføje æ,ø og å til de embed tegn?
Avatar billede rafix Nybegynder
22. november 2005 - 12:03 #4
Undskylder sen tilbagemelding..
Jeg har gjort som du forslår uden held, men har fundet ud af at det måske er serveren som har problemer?? Jeg bixer lidt med problemet og skal nok lige ligge en besked så snart jeg har fundet løsningen (hvis jeg finder den!).
Avatar billede alexander_j Nybegynder
12. juli 2008 - 20:20 #5
Tid til at lukke?
Avatar billede Ny bruger Nybegynder

Din løsning...

Tilladte BB-code-tags: [b]fed[/b] [i]kursiv[/i] [u]understreget[/u] Web- og emailadresser omdannes automatisk til links. Der sættes "nofollow" på alle links.

Loading billede Opret Preview
Kategori
IT-kurser om Microsoft 365, sikkerhed, personlig vækst, udvikling, digital markedsføring, grafisk design, SAP og forretningsanalyse.

Log ind eller opret profil

Hov!

For at kunne deltage på Computerworld Eksperten skal du være logget ind.

Det er heldigvis nemt at oprette en bruger: Det tager to minutter og du kan vælge at bruge enten e-mail, Facebook eller Google som login.

Du kan også logge ind via nedenstående tjenester